Transaction 571505549bb54b17845c23b2e738a2b8d43d30d57bd44f80f45a4fdfa3fc71ac

1 Input
2 Outputs
  • 571505549bb54b17845c23b2e738a2b8d43d30d57bd44f80f45a4fdfa3fc71ac:0
  • value  7188721273
    address  mttPryztcge8xyz5m6ZrdQhU7cK4SLekd1
  • 571505549bb54b17845c23b2e738a2b8d43d30d57bd44f80f45a4fdfa3fc71ac:1
  • value  1323305
    address  mhbb5SByAMD7MFYPJGiTK1Bu2jg1LnH2ZH